Live casino games introduce a new format for players seeking a realistic experience. Instead of a digital simulation with a software number generator, a live broadcast from a studio is launched on the screen. A dealer manually controls the process, cameras capture every move, and players place bets in real-time through the website or mobile app interface.

What are live casino games? It’s not just an alternative to traditional slots but a complete immersion into the atmosphere of a real casino floor. Bets are placed instantly, dealer actions are broadcasted in HD quality, and the interface allows not only to follow the process but also interact with other participants through chat. This approach breaks down the barrier between the screen and reality, creating a unique level of engagement.

Live casino platforms use specialized software developed by studios like Evolution, Pragmatic Play Live, or Playtech Live. These companies create studio rooms with multiple cameras, additional screens, and an automated betting management system. Each table functions like a TV studio, where a director, cameraman, and technician ensure the quality of the broadcast, while the dealer maintains the gameplay. Players experience a fully interactive scene with minimal delay.

What are live casino games: live interaction vs. generator

What are live casino games? It’s a format where every action happens in real-time under the control of a live person. There is no automatic symbol generation; each roulette spin or card dealing is the result of a real physical action by the dealer. This completely distinguishes live casinos from regular ones, where slots, roulette, or card games are initiated by RNG – random number generators.

A simple example: when a player presses the “spin” button on a slot, the system instantly calculates the result and displays it as an animation. In a live game, the dealer spins the Wheel of Fortune or deals a card, while the camera captures the movement, transmitting the signal to the server. The difference lies in visualization, the sense of control, and the perception of fairness. The live format reduces suspicions of manipulation and builds trust.

Live games present themselves as a show – with studio design, dealer voice commentary, musical accompaniment, and camera angle changes. Each round becomes an event, not just the start of an algorithm. This transforms a standard game into a full performance.

Key technologies in live online casino games

What are live casino games? First and foremost, a complex technological system. Behind the visual convenience, there are dozens of processes synchronizing the broadcast, bets, and game process management. Platforms use their own servers with minimal latency, adaptive graphics, and connection security. User-side rendering algorithms ensure smooth visuals even with unstable internet.

Dealers interact with the interface through the Game Control Unit (GCU) module – a device attached under the table. It automatically encrypts each dealer action, links physical mechanics with digital bets, and ensures security. High-resolution cameras (up to 4K) transmit the stream in real-time, dividing the image into several angles – wide shot, close-up, additional visual effects.

Software from leading developers supports automatic display of winnings, bet synchronization, and instant transaction confirmation. Players see chip layouts changing on the screen, displaying amounts and multipliers. This level of precision eliminates errors and allows the system to register millions of operations without delays.

Additionally, live online casino games connect to independent verification systems. Some providers integrate blockchain technologies to confirm bets, while others use AI moderation to monitor dealer and player actions, automatically detecting violations or suspicious behavior.

Interface adaptation: gaming on all devices

Modern platforms create interfaces that automatically adapt to screen sizes. When the phone is turned horizontally, the camera widens the field of view, and large buttons allow for one-handed betting.

Mobile versions support all functions: chat, table selection, quality change of the broadcast, camera switching. A player can switch from observing to participating in seconds, with the entire history of bets and winnings saved. Built-in animations and touch response provide maximum control even on a small screen.

Optimization affects not only the interface but also data flow. The platform automatically adjusts the bitrate according to internet speed to prevent video buffering. In case of a connection interruption, the server records the current bet and offers to resume it after reconnecting. This protection is critical in real-time gaming, where a 2-second delay could mean a missed win.

Welcome Bonus: The Most Common Offer in Online Casinos

A welcome bonus is one of the most popular rewards at online casinos and is intended for new players. Usually, you will receive this form immediately after registration and the first deposit. This is a great way for a casino to attract new users by offering them extra money to wager. The welcome bonus can consist of a certain amount of money or a percentage of the deposit.

How does the welcome bonus work?

Rewards are generally offered in two forms:

  1. 100% First Deposit Bonus: Players receive double the initial deposit amount. For example, if a participant contributes 1,000 rubles, he or she will receive another 1,000 rubles as a gift.
  2. Unconditional bonus: Sometimes the site offers a fixed amount that does not depend on the player’s deposit. Example: A newcomer who registers at a casino and deposits 5,000 rubles will receive a 100% bonus on the deposit, allowing him to start a session with 10,000 rubles.

Deposit and no deposit bonuses

The two most common types of rewards at online casinos are deposit bonuses and no deposit bonuses. The first option gives players the opportunity to earn extra money by replenishing their account, and the second option does not require them to deposit any money.

Difference:

  1. Deposit bonus: Requires a cash deposit, but gives you extra money to play with. Often offers up to 200% off your first deposit.
  2. No-deposit bonus: This allows you to start playing without making a deposit, but the terms and conditions may be stricter, such as withdrawal restrictions.

Example: A player who has received a no-deposit bonus of 500 rubles can use it to bet, but in order to withdraw money, he must meet the wagering requirements.

Cashback: Money paid back to players

Cashback allows players to get back some of the money they lost. Typically, the notation is shown as a percentage of the loss amount, for example, 10% of the week’s losses. This is a great way for casinos to retain players by giving them the chance to win back at least some of their money.

Casino Wagering Requirements (Wagering Requirements)

The wagering requirement is a multiplier that indicates how many times bonus money or winnings must be wagered before they can be withdrawn. It is important for players to understand the terms so that they do not get confused and are not confused by overly complicated rules.

Key features of the bet:

  1. If the wagering requirement is x30 and the player has received a bonus of 3,000 rubles, he must place bets worth 90,000 rubles (3,000 × 30) before he can withdraw the winnings.
  2. Difficulty of betting: High wagering requirements can make the process of receiving winnings long.

Example: If a player uses a bonus with a wagering requirement of 35, he/she must go through several wagering requirements before he/she can withdraw the money.
